Are Lexus repair costs higher in Lancaster County compared to taking my car to a dealer in a bigger city?

Labor rates in Lancaster County are generally competitive, and you may find savings versus dealerships in major metropolitan areas. However, genuine Lexus parts and specialized labor command a premium everywhere; always request a detailed estimate that breaks down OEM vs. aftermarket part options.

What are common Lexus repair issues for drivers in the Pequea area given our local roads and climate?

Rural roads around Pequea can be tough on suspension components, leading to wear on control arms and bushings. Furthermore, Pennsylvania winters with road salt contribute to brake corrosion and potential issues with luxury features like power folding mirrors or sunroof drains, which should be checked regularly.

How do I know if a local shop is truly qualified to work on my Lexus hybrid system?

It is critical to verify specific hybrid system training and certification. Ask the shop directly about their technicians' credentials (e.g., ASE Hybrid/Electric Vehicle certification) and their investment in proper Lexus-specific diagnostic tools, as hybrid repairs require specialized expertise for safety and performance.

When should I seek local service for my Lexus versus going to the dealership for maintenance?

For routine maintenance like oil changes, tire rotations, and brake service, a qualified local independent shop can provide excellent value. For complex warranty work, advanced electronic diagnostics, or recalls, the authorized Lexus dealership in Lancaster is the required and most equipped destination.
